From c2d3e19c481edd9b1f10f6882051c207fec4b7da Mon Sep 17 00:00:00 2001 From: Timo K Date: Wed, 24 Jan 2024 17:24:39 +0100 Subject: [PATCH] dont register in widget mode Signed-off-by: Timo K --- src/auth/useRegisterPasswordlessUser.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/auth/useRegisterPasswordlessUser.ts b/src/auth/useRegisterPasswordlessUser.ts index d34a479e..bb757da9 100644 --- a/src/auth/useRegisterPasswordlessUser.ts +++ b/src/auth/useRegisterPasswordlessUser.ts @@ -21,6 +21,7 @@ import { useClient } from "../ClientContext"; import { useInteractiveRegistration } from "../auth/useInteractiveRegistration"; import { generateRandomName } from "../auth/generateRandomName"; import { useRecaptcha } from "../auth/useRecaptcha"; +import { widget } from "../widget"; interface UseRegisterPasswordlessUserType { privacyPolicyUrl?: string; @@ -39,6 +40,9 @@ export function useRegisterPasswordlessUser(): UseRegisterPasswordlessUserType { if (!setClient) { throw new Error("No client context"); } + if (widget) { + throw new Error("We never register passwordless user in widget"); + } try { const recaptchaResponse = await execute();